Research

Be sure to do research. Get facts and stats. Look at both sides of the issue before you establish your opinion. Look for arguments from a variety of sources. Do not rely exclusively on any one medium. Professional journals are some of the best.

Writing
Organize your essay in a way that makes sense. Read your essay to yourself aloud. If it sounds right to your ear, it is probably right. Organization has a flow to it, and your essay should flow. Point should follow point. As you introduce your arguments in the first paragraph, discuss them in the same order in the paragrpahs after.

Revising
Lose the first person language. Your essay is you speaking. It is redundant to say, "I am going to tell you what I think and this is it." Using the first person in an essay is doing exactly that. So just say what you have to say in direct statements. Read over your essay several times outloud to make sure it sounds right. Check spelling, grammar, and punctuation last. These things are not trivial; if you can't use proper grammar, people will be less likely to trust what you're saying, but you need to be certain your paper is contructed as it should be. To make sure you caught all those little mistakes, it helps if you have someone else read it, and it helps you if the mechanical parts of your writing is the last act you perform on your paper.

Final Copy
Make a nice, clean final copy. It helps if you have it typed up nicely. Picking a standard block font and maybe adding some graphics can help the appeal. Do not go overboard on the graphics though. Use only what supports your work, and cite it.


Proof read it several times. Stick to your topic. Keep it simple. Follow the rules or guidelines for the essay. Give support to your ideas.

An essay is a long piece of writing and it is written in paragraphs

An essay consists of three major parts:

  • the introduction
  • the main body
  • the conclusion

The introduction and the conclusion, although very important, are often relatively short. The bulk of an essay, both in form and substance, is contained in the main body.

The introduction is intended to lead the reader into the topic and clarify what the essay will specifically deal with. It usually consists of one paragraph, but this depends on the length of the essay and the amount of background information the context requires. The introduction will contain a key sentence (or, if necessary, more than one).

The main body deals with the major ideas that support the the statement. Each main idea is presented in a separate paragraph and developed with supporting ideas in the form of explanations, definitions, or similar, and illustrated with examples where appropriate or necessary.

The conclusion brings the reader back to the purpose of the essay and draws all the points together before making a final comment on the result of the discussion/argument. Often this final comment will point towards some consequence the discussion may have for the future or make some observation about what the discussion has revealed on a general level.

Ultimately an essay will show a progression from a general level (in the introduction) down to the specific (the statement and body) and back up to the general level again(conclusion). The reader will be expecting this so it gives your essay a sense of completion.

If you're writing a 5 paragraph essay, you want to have an introduction, 3 body paragraphs and then your conclusion.

Your intro should start with an attention grabber (question, joke etc.) Slowly build up towards your thesis, which should be at the end.

Your body paragraphs each should have a main point, communicated in the first sentence, called a topic sentence. You topic sentences should tie back to you thesis. the next 4ish sentences of the body paragraph should support the topic sentence. Then, you should have a conclusion sentence, which wraps up the paragraph and/or is a transition to the next paragraph.

Your conclusion should first restate the thesis, then wrap up your essay. Ending with something dramatic like an attention grabber is helpful.

Which of these lists the different steps of the writing process in the correct order?

In order to state which lists the different steps of the writing process in the correct order the list would have to be provided. There are five steps to the writing process. These steps, in order, are pre-writing, drafting, revising, editing, and publishing.


What writing explains a process?

The type of writing that explains a process is known as a how-to essay. This essay explains how to accomplish a task or process in chronological order, and explicit detail.
